What Is a Cautery Pencil?

A Cautery Pencil, also described as an electrosurgical pencil or diathermy cautery handpiece, is a handheld monopolar accessory used to hold an active electrode and activate compatible electrosurgical energy. Depending on the design, activation occurs through buttons on the handpiece or through a separate foot switch connected to the electrosurgical unit.

The handpiece forms part of a larger system. The selected electrode, cable, connector, generator and return-electrode arrangement must all be compatible with the intended use. Product selection should follow the manufacturer’s specifications and approved instructions rather than visual similarity alone.

Main Types of Cautery Pencils and Handpieces

Hand Control Cautery Pencils

Hand Control Cautery Pencils include activation controls on the handpiece. Common designs provide separate cut and coagulation buttons so the user can activate the selected mode without operating a foot switch.

When evaluating hand-control models, buyers should assess button position, tactile response, identification of the controls, resistance to unintended activation, sealing around the control area and compatibility with the required generator connection.

Foot Control Cautery Pencils

Foot Control Cautery Pencils are activated through a compatible foot switch rather than buttons on the handpiece. This creates a simpler handpiece profile and allows activation to remain under foot control.

Detachable Cautery Handpieces

Detachable Cautery Handpiece designs use separable components where permitted by the product specification. They may support a reusable workflow or make particular components easier to manage, but their connections, assembly steps and reprocessing instructions require careful review.

Buyers should confirm which components are reusable, replaceable or single use. They should also check how the product is assembled, inspected and stored after reprocessing.

Single-Use Diathermy Cautery Pencils

Single-Use Diathermy Cautery Pencils are supplied for one procedure and may be selected for facilities that prefer a sterile, procedure-ready format. Their evaluation should include sterile packaging, shelf life, cable length, electrode configuration, labelling and disposal requirements.

A single-use product should not be selected only because it removes reprocessing. Buyers must compare the total procedural cost, storage needs, waste responsibilities and supply continuity with the reusable alternative.

Hand Control or Foot Control: What Is the Difference?

Feature Hand Control Foot Control
Activation Buttons on the handpiece Compatible external foot switch
Handpiece profile Includes integrated controls Typically simpler control surface
System check Button function, cable and generator connection Handpiece, foot switch and generator compatibility
Buying decision Based on user preference and compatible system Based on workflow, foot-switch setup and compatible system

Neither activation method is universally better. The appropriate choice depends on the facility’s equipment, workflow, user preference and intended procedure.

Eight Checks Before Approving a Cautery Pencil

  1. Activation Method

Confirm whether the requirement is hand control, foot control or a detachable format. Product descriptions and packaging should make this distinction clear so buyers do not receive the wrong version.

  1. Electrode Shaft Compatibility

The handpiece must accept the intended electrode shaft correctly. Check the supported diameter, retention method and approved electrode configuration. A loose or incompatible fit cannot be corrected by assuming that nearby dimensions are close enough.

  1. Generator and Connector Compatibility

Document the generator connection and compatible system before ordering. A connector that appears familiar may have different dimensions, pin arrangements or intended compatibility. For foot-control models, include the foot switch in the system review.

  1. Cable Length and Flexibility

Cable length affects theatre setup, while flexibility and strain relief influence handling. Buyers should confirm the standard cable specification and ensure that the evaluated sample matches future production.

  1. Body Sealing and Insulation

Inspect the handpiece body, joints, control area, cable entry and insulation.   1. Button Response and Identification

For hand-control models, the cut and coagulation controls should be clearly identified and provide a consistent response. Samples should be evaluated for button placement, tactile feedback and ease of use while wearing surgical gloves.

  1. Ergonomic Profile

Diameter, weight, grip area and balance affect comfort and manoeuvrability. A slim design may be preferred, but the correct choice should come from representative sample evaluation rather than a marketing description.

  1. Reusable or Single-Use Requirements

Reusable products need clear cleaning, inspection, sterilisation and service-life guidance. Single-use products need appropriate sterile packaging, shelf-life evidence and traceability. Confirm the labelled status for every product reference.

Documentation Buyers Should Request

A responsible Cautery Pencil Manufacturer should be able to identify the documents applicable to the ordered product and destination market. Depending on the device and programme, buyers may need:

  • Product specifications and article-number details
  • Instructions for use and reprocessing information
  • Applicable quality and conformity documentation
  • Connector, electrode and generator compatibility information
  • Labelling and packaging specifications
  • Sterilisation and shelf-life information for sterile single-use products
  • Traceability, complaint and change-control procedures

Documentation should relate to the exact product under review. A general company certificate is not a substitute for product-level information.

Reusable vs Single-Use Cautery Pencils

The choice between a reusable and single-use Cautery Pencil should be based on the facility’s workflow, reprocessing capability, storage, purchasing model and procedural requirements.

  • Reusable handpieces may offer long-term value when correctly inspected and reprocessed within the manufacturer’s stated limits.
  • Single-use pencils provide a sterile, procedure-ready option but require ongoing stock, shelf-life and waste management.

Procurement teams should compare the total cost and operational fit of both formats. The lowest unit cost does not always represent the lowest cost per procedure.

Frequently Asked Questions

Is a Cautery Pencil the same as an electrosurgical pencil?

The terms are often used for the handheld accessory that holds an active electrode and connects to a compatible monopolar electrosurgical system. Product naming varies, so buyers should confirm the exact specification rather than relying on terminology alone.

What is the difference between hand-control and foot-control cautery pencils?

A hand-control model uses buttons on the handpiece. A foot-control model is activated through a compatible foot switch. The correct option depends on the generator, theatre setup and user preference.

Can one Cautery Pencil accept every electrode?

No. Electrode shaft diameter, retention design and approved compatibility can differ. Confirm the supported electrode specifications for each handpiece.

Are cautery pencils reusable?

Both reusable and single-use products are available. Follow the labelled status and manufacturer’s instructions for the exact article.

What should be included in a quotation request?

Specify hand or foot control, electrode shaft size, generator connection, cable length, reusable or single-use status, quantity, destination market, packaging and OEM requirements.

Why should buyers evaluate a physical sample?

A sample allows assessment of grip, button response, cable flexibility, electrode retention and connector fit—details that cannot be confirmed from a photograph.
